The first exercise that could be a problem with shoulder pain is one you might not immediately think of and that's the pullup. In the case of a labrum tear, this can be one of the most aggravating exercises. The fix here is to depress your shoulders - create distance between your ears and your biceps as you hang from the bar. When you are lowering yourself down from the top of the pull-up, there are 2 things you need to do. The first is to slow yourself down as you descend. The second is to never disengage the packing of your shoulders throughout the rep. This will let you keep getting the benefits of the pullup without aggravating a compromised labrum.

The next troublesome exercise for a bum shoulder is an obvious one that, again, you shouldn't be skipping. That is the bench press. Most people experience shoulder pain or shoulder discomfort on the bench press when they use a barbell. That is because of the fixed arm position of the arms when using the bar. If you are going to use a barbell to bench press, then you will want to take a more narrow grip. This will help with elbow positioning in preventing you from flaring your arms out to the sides (incurring greater internal rotation) as well as activating the lats to stabilize the press. In many cases, I would say that if a barbell bench press is causing shoulder pain, then you're likely better off switching to dumbbells. This will allow freedom to tuck the elbows as much as needed to avoid shoulder pain. The key here is to go slow to create greater stability.

If there is one exercise you should skip altogether when it comes to working out with shoulder pain, it would be the upright row. It's just not a good exercise due to its ability to create shoulder problems in the first place (such as with impingement) and any benefits it has when it comes to shoulder growth can be mirrored by another, safer exercise. In this instance, simply opt to perform a dumbbell high pull instead. The added benefit of external rotation at the top of the rep will help prevent impingement and promote healthy shoulder mechanics.

We don't only have to focus on the upper body to find exercises that will be tough on a creaky shoulder. As a matter of fact, the king of leg exercises, the squat, can be a big problem if you don't have the right shoulder mobility. I'm specifically talking about the low bar squat, which requires a lot of shoulder external rotation to get into the proper position. However, we have some simple fixes so you can still squat without pain. If low bar squatting is what you want to do, try a wider grip for less shoulder mobility demand. Otherwise, you can switch to a high bar squat or a front squat, which will still have a heavy impact on your leg growth.

Now, I've heard time and time again that if you have bad shoulders, you shouldn't do dips. I disagree. I think you just need to pay attention to how you are performing the exercise. The first thing to take note of is that you should be taking the same tip from the pullups when it comes to depressing your shoulder blades - keep your shoulders back and down throughout the entire movement. On top of that, stick your chest out. A proud chest will make sure your chest is taking the brunt of the work instead of the shoulders. Don't think you need some extreme amount of stretch at the bottom of the rep either. Cut your depth a little short to where you are getting some stretch on the pecs without aggravating your shoulder pain.
